Crystal structure analysis of dengue-1 envelope protein domain III

Function

[Q9J7C6_9FLAV] Envelope protein E binding to host cell surface receptor is followed by virus internalization through clathrin-mediated endocytosis. Envelope protein E is subsequently involved in membrane fusion between virion and host late endosomes. Synthesized as a homodimer with prM which acts as a chaperone for envelope protein E. After cleavage of prM, envelope protein E dissociate from small envelope protein M and homodimerizes (By similarity).[SAAS:SAAS026470_004_099774]

About this Structure

3irc is a 1 chain structure with sequence from Dengue virus 1. This structure supersedes the now removed PDB entry 3egp. Full crystallographic information is available from OCA.
